HomeMy WebLinkAbout06-20-1978 MINUTES OF THE CITY COMMISSION MEETING OF THE CITY OF OCOEE HELD 20 JUNE 1978 I I I Mayor Breeze called the meeting to order at 7:30 P.M. and the meeting was opened with the Pledge of Allegiance to the Flag. Present were comm.Stinnett, Crawford and Whitehead; City Manager, vignetti; City Attorney, Rhodes; and City Clerk, Gann. Comm. Lyle was absent. 6 JUNE 78 COMMISSION MEETING MINUTES Comm. Whitehead moved to accept the minutes as presented, seconded Comm. Crawford. Unanimous. ZONING BOARD DID NOT MEET TRANSFER OF BEER/WINE LICENSE Mr. Dye requested that his beer/wine license for the Shell Station located on SR 50 be transfered to the new owner, Bruce Begley. Comm. Stinnett moved to approve the request, seconded comm. Crawford. Unanimous. GROUP HEALTH INSURANCE City Manager stated that the present group health policy expired 1 August 78 and there would be an approximate 28% increase in cost if the city continued coverage with Prudential. City Manager further stated that council needed to make a decision to either stay with Prudential or put insurance out for bids. Anthony Greco, Prudential Agent explained the increases. Comm.Stinnett moved to stay with Prudential, seconded Comm. Crawford. Unanimous. REPORTS AND INFORMATION - CITY MANAGER City Manager reported the following: There has been 6,080' of sidewalks completed in the city to date for a cost of $29,923.80 and there is approximately $6,000 left to spend on sidewalks before July. Recommended constructing sidewalks starting at Lady Ave. on the south side of Ursula Street to the intersection of Doreen Ave. Comm.Crawford moved to approve the recommendation, seconded Comm. Whitehead. Unanimous. Requested authorization to pay: a. Hubbard Construction $36,000.00, Street Dept.,Acct #7048 b. Central Florida Underground, $7,200.00, Water O&M Acct #1321 c. Brownie Septic Tank, $580.00, Recreation Acct.#908l Comm. Stinnett moved to approve the requests for payment, seconded Comm. Crawford. Unanimous. Cost to repair baseball field/tennis court lights $847.70. According to L.M. zeigler it will cost $2000. to repair air conditioner at Youth Center. Comm.Stinnett recommended moving the air conditioner units to the roof. Comm. Crawford moved to obtain bids on repairing the air conditionel and moving it to the roof, seconded Comm. Whitehead. Unanimous. Requested permission to raise Nancy Hardy from $75.00 per week to the minimum wage ($2.65 per hr.). Comm. Whitehead moved to grant the request, seconded Comm. Stinnett. Unanimous. Jim Beech stated that he had been in contact with the President and Vice- President of Senior League and they had assured him that a work session on the building was planned for Thursday. Council agreed to wait until Friday before making any decisions. ADJOURNMENT Meeting adjourned at 8:09 P.M. ATTEST: s I II
